About

Wayne Carle Middle School opened in August of 2006. The school was built to help with overcrowding at Mandalay Middle School and to feed Standley Lake and Ralston Valley High Schools. Our school is named for Dr. Wayne Carle, who was a valued educator, principal, and administrator in Jefferson County for many years.
